The remote island settlement of Talmandor’s Bounty is thrown into chaos as a strange magical effect plunges the region into shadow. Urged to investigate the event, the PCs travel to a nearby island and discover an ancient Azlanti prison that was buried during Earthfall. Inside, a cult of the blood god Camazotz thrives, and in dealing with them the PCs learn that greater threats lay deeper inside the ancient complex. Can the PCs discover who’s behind the supernatural shadow and stop them before it’s too late?
Thirst for Blood is a Pathfinder Adventure for four 1st-level characters. This adventure begins the Shades of Blood Adventure Path, a three-part monthly campaign in which a group of adventurers explore a ruined ancient prison to stop a vampiric threat to cover the skies in shadow. This volume also includes a look into Camazotz, god of bats, blood, caverns, and nocturnal predators, a gazetteer of the island settlement of Talmandor’s Bounty, new player options, and a selection of dangerous monsters.
Each monthly full-color softcover Pathfinder Adventure Path volume contains an in-depth adventure scenario, stats for several new monsters, and support articles meant to give Game Masters additional material to expand their campaign.

Yep! There is a gazetteer of Talmandor's Bounty in this book, written by Jim Groves who fleshed out the settlement for Ruins of Azlant. I'm glad he was available too! I really wanted to give him the first shot at updating the place.
Also, for full disclosure, there's not a lot of focus on Talmandor's Bounty beyond the first volume, but there should be enough in the gazetteer for a GM to spice things up for their players when their characters come back to town to rest.
